Description

The fourth edition of Young Adult Literature in Action retains its popular genre organization to teach library and information science students and professional librarians how to select quality books for young adults.

Showcasing the best and most up-to-date young adult literature, this well-regarded textbook provides a survey of YA lit for undergraduate and graduate students seeking licensures and degrees leading to careers working with young adults in school and public libraries. Valuable resources include updated “Librarians in Action” sections for each chapter as well as new:

· collaborative activities
· featured books
· special topics and programs
· selected awards and celebrations
· historical connections
· recommended resources
· issues for discussion
· assignment suggestions

Special emphasis is placed on the role of book formats and the relevance of librarians serving both younger and older teen populations. Middle-grade recommendations and authors are also featured in each chapter, and book recommendation lists include middle-grade titles. Updated information on new media applications such as audiobooks and social media and an increased focus on graphic novels and manga make this edition the most timely and comprehensive young adult literature textbook available.
